About The Position

The Manufacturing Continuous Improvement Engineer is a hands-on role responsible for improving manufacturing systems, processes, and performance through data analysis and structured continuous improvement. This position works directly on the production floor to identify problems, analyze root causes, and implement sustainable improvements related to parts, processes, material flow, and operational systems. This role is not a desk-only position. Success requires regular presence on the shop floor, strong problem-solving skills, and the ability to turn data into actionable improvement.

Responsibilities

  • Lead and support continuous improvement projects focused on safety, quality, delivery, cost, and productivity.
  • Apply structured problem-solving methods (RCA, 5-Why, Fishbone, PDCA, DMAIC) to recurring operational issues.
  • Drive corrective and preventive actions through implementation and verification.
  • Analyze manufacturing processes, material flow, and work standards to identify waste, variation, and inefficiencies.
  • Support improvements to plant safety, 6S, scheduling, inventory control, part flow, and work sequencing.
  • Develop and improve standard work, visual management, and process documentation.
  • Collect, analyze, and interpret operational data (production, quality, scrap, downtime, inventory, etc.).
  • Identify trends, risks, and opportunities using data rather than assumptions.
  • Develop simple, effective metrics, dashboards, and reporting tools to support decision-making.
  • Ensure improvement sustainability utilizing layered process audits and development of sustainability metrics.
  • Support part-related and process-related issues including flow constraints, quality concerns, and change implementation.
  • Collaborate with Quality, Engineering, Supply Chain, and Production to resolve issues impacting performance.
  • Assist with new process implementation, changes, and validation as needed.
  • Work directly with operators, supervisors, and managers to identify issues and implement improvements.
  • Facilitate improvement events, kaizen activities, and cross-functional problem-solving sessions.
  • Coach teams on CI tools, data usage, and disciplined execution.
